The Certified Specialist Programme in Indoor Herb Gardens provides comprehensive training for aspiring indoor gardening professionals. Participants gain practical skills in cultivating a wide variety of herbs indoors, mastering techniques crucial for successful growth in controlled environments.
Learning outcomes encompass plant propagation, soil science specific to indoor herb growing, pest and disease management tailored to indoor settings, and the design and maintenance of efficient indoor herb growing systems. You'll also develop expertise in harvesting, preserving, and utilizing your homegrown herbs.
The programme typically runs for six months, combining online modules with practical workshops. This blended learning approach ensures a thorough understanding of both theoretical and practical aspects of indoor herb cultivation. The flexible schedule caters to both beginners and experienced gardeners.
